Python读取Excel表格:三种高效方法解析

创始人
2024-12-16 22:39:29
0 次浏览
0 评论

Python读取Excel表格的几种方法

使用Python以不同方式读取Excel电子表格是学习数据分析和数据科学的关键技能之一。
本文将详细介绍三种方法:使用Python内置的open()方法、使用pandas读取Excel文件、使用pandas的read_excel()函数。
首先,尝试使用Python的内置open()方法读取文本文件。
设置相对路径`example/ex2.txt`,文本内容为“测试一下内容,路径和内容,可以根据自己的心情设置”。
但是,当你尝试读取时,open()方法的默认编码可能不支持中文,导致读取失败。
解决办法是手动指定文件的编码通过在open()方法中添加`encoding='utf-8'参数,成功读取包含中文的文本文件。
接下来,使用pandas库读取Excel文件。
由于读取Excel格式的文件可能需要额外的包,例如“xlrd”和“openpyxl”,因此您应该根据错误要求安装它们。
尝试使用ExcelFile进行读取时,您可能会遇到版本兼容性问题。
该问题的解决方案是将`xlrd`的版本更改为1.2.0。
通过安装较新版本的“xlrd”,可以成功读取Excel文件。
最后,使用pandas的read_excel()函数提供了一种更简单、更直接的方法来读取Excel中的表格。
该方法不需要额外的包,简化了读取过程,使数据处理更加方便。
通过“read_excel()”函数可以高效读取Excel文件中的数据。
通过上面介绍的三种方法,学生可以根据当前的需求和环境,灵活选择最适合的Excel表格读取方式,提高数据处理的效率和准确性。

python怎么读取并输出excel表格数据?

使用Python读取并输出Excel表格数据的步骤如下:首先定义目标:将Excel表格中的数据A1填充到新表格的单元格A3、A4和A5中,将数据A2写入B3和表2中的B4。
在网格B5中。
具体步骤如下:第一步,获取Excel文件列表。
将所有Excel文件放在特定目录下,例如“D:\Test”,使用os.listdir获取该目录下的所有文件名。
第二步,使用pd.read_excel()函数读取每个Excel文件的数据。
第三步是整合来自不同Excel文件的数据。
将读取的数据合并在一起。
第四步,调整数据的顺序。
使用pd.T执行转置操作并调整数据数组的顺序。
第五步,使用pd.to_excel()函数将排序后的数据输出到新的Excel文档中。
总结一下方法,首先通过os.listdir获取Excel文件的名称,然后使用pd.read_excel()读取文件数据,然后组合并调整数据的顺序,最后使用pd.to_excel()来将数据写入新的Excel文件中。
这样,多个Excel文件中的数据可以集成并输出到一个新文件中。
文章标签:
Python Excel
热门文章
1
Python中的format()方法:字... formatformat在python中的含义2222.22E+00Format...

2
Python编程入门:全面解析Pytho... python的基本语法基本的Python语法如下:1.变量的定义。在编程语言中,...

3
Python爱心绘制教程:使用turtl... python的爱心代码教程(python画爱心代码)绘制心形的Python代码我...

4
Python字符串大小写转换方法全解析 python中字母的大小写转换怎么实现?在Python中,大小写转换由内置函数处...

5
Python字典:轻松获取最小值键与计算... python在一个字典里,返回值最小元素对应的键,救解在Python字典中,如果...

6
Python字符串去重空格:strip(... Python去除字符串中空格(删除指定字符)的3种方法在Python编程中,处理...

7
Python数组元素数量计算技巧分享 Python输出数组有多少个元素?简介:在本文中,首席CTO笔记将向您介绍Pyt...

8
简述python中pass的作用 pass语句的作用在许多编程语言中,包括Python;PASS语句用于在代码块中...

9
Python def 关键字详解:函数定... def是什么意思编程?戴夫是什么意思?def是Python中的函数定义关键字,用...

10
python不区分大小写的方法 Python字符串不区分大小写在Python中,字符串操作默认区分大小写。但有时...